Description

Based on the SmartBond™ DA14695 Bluetooth® Low Energy (LE) 5.2 system-on-chip (SoC), the DA14695 module brings out all the DA14695 hardware features and capabilities. The module integrates all passives, antenna, and a 32Mbit QSPI FLASH, and is supported by software that is easy to work with. The DA14695 module targets broad market use and will be certified across regions providing significant reductions in development cost and risks, and time-to-market.
